Midday Markets: Net stocks prop up techs

3 min read

After a slow start, Internet stocks supported slacking techs at midday Thursday. Compaq and Western Digital struggled following profit warnings. The Nasdaq shifted up 18.11 to 2,535, while the Dow Jones industrial average skipped 6.97 up to 10,791.92.

Inter@ctive Week's @Net Index rose 6.89 to 291.22.

Federal Reserve Chairman Alan Greenspan dropped no new nuggets in his testimony to the Joint Economic Committee. He reiterated that the U.S. central bank is squarely focused on keeping product prices stable.

Bad news for Compaq Computer Corp.(NYSE: CPQ) pushed prices down 1/16 to 22 3/16. The company said it will report a second quarter loss of 5 cents per share below estimates. Shares were well off their lows, however.

Other PC notables included Hewlett Packard Co. (NYSE: HWP), which was down 2 1/4 to 88 1/2. Apple (Nasdaq: AAPL) also fell 1 to 46 15/16. DELL (Nasdaq: DELL) rose 3/4 to 36 9/16,and IBM (NYSE: IBM) was down 9/16 to 120 1/8. Gateway Inc. (NYSE: GTW) added 17/16 to 66 7/8.

Western Digital Corp. (NYSE: WDC) dropped 3/8 to 6 1/2 after announcing that fourth quarter losses would be in the range of 90 cents a share to 98 cents a share. Competitor Seagate (NYSE: SEG) fell 7/8 to 28 1/8. Quantum (Nasdaq: QNTM) was up 1/2 to 22 7/16, and Komag Inc. (Nasdaq: KMAG) jumped 1/8 to 3 5/8.

Micron Technology Inc. (NYSE: MU) got a boost to 1 3/16 to 45 5/16 after ABN AMRO upgraded the stock from an "outperform" to a "buy" recommendation Wednesday.
